The Meaning Behind the Name

The name TEWATASHI holds deep cultural significance in Japan, translating to “handing over” or “passing something valuable.” In this case, it represents the act of passing freshly prepared sushi directly from the chef to the guest.
Sushi, contrary to popular belief, is not intended to be a preserved food. It is best enjoyed within 10 seconds of preparation, when the precise balance of rice and fish is at its peak. At TEWATASHI, we honour this tradition, ensuring guests experience sushi as it was originally intended – fresh, perfect, and straight from the chef’s hands.

Edo-mae Sushi

TEWATASHI specializes in Edo-mae sushi, a traditional style from Tokyo, where freshness, simplicity, and skill come together. Our sushi is a celebration of the season’s best offerings, hand-selected and prepared by our expert chefs to highlight the natural flavors of the finest ingredients.

The Omakase Experience

At TEWATASHI, diners will enjoy a refined omakase experience – a chef’s selection of seasonal dishes crafted using traditional Japanese techniques. The omakase service is split into two distinct dining styles:

• Izakaya Style: A lively, social experience where guests can enjoy an array of small Japanese dishes paired with sake, designed for sharing and conversation.
• Live Sushi: For the second seating, the chef presents sushi directly to diners, made-to-order and delivered from hand to hand, embodying the very essence of the TEWATASHI concept. This unique interaction ensures the highest quality and freshness of every bite.
